AirSculpt (AIRS) stock outlook | market momentum and investor sentiment remain in focus. Shares of AirSculpt Technologies Inc. (AIRS) declined 2.48% to $5.35 in recent trading, as the stock continues to test lower levels. The price is now approaching a critical support zone near $5.08, while resistance stands at $5.62. This move places the stock near the lower end of its recent trading range, drawing attention from both short-term traders and longer-term holders.

The 2.48% drop to $5.35 reflects selling pressure that may be linked to broader sector weakness or company-specific concerns within the aesthetics and body‑contouring industry. Trading volume during the session was consistent with recent average levels, suggesting no unusual panic selling, but rather a continued downward drift. AirSculpt operates in a competitive niche where consumer discretionary spending trends, marketing effectiveness, and procedure demand are key drivers. The stock’s decline could be influenced by profit‑taking after any prior rally, investor reaction to competitive dynamics, or a reassessment of near‑term growth expectations. With the price now just 5.3% above the $5.08 support, the move has pushed the stock into a region where oversold conditions may be developing. This level has historically acted as a floor, and any further weakness would bring the stock closer to that zone. The resistance at $5.62 remains a hurdle; the stock last tested that area before rolling over. The current price action suggests that bears remain in control in the short term, though the proximity to support could invite bargain hunters. Technically, AirSculpt’s price action shows a series of lower highs over recent sessions, with the current $5.35 close representing a low within the near‑term range. The stock is trading below both its short‑term and intermediate‑term moving averages, a configuration that often signals bearish momentum. The relative strength index (RSI) may be in the low‑to‑mid 30s range, indicating that the stock could be approaching oversold territory. Should the RSI dip further, it could increase the probability of a technical bounce. The $5.08 support level is a prior swing low that has provided a base in the past; if it holds, the stock could form a double‑bottom pattern, which would be a bullish reversal signal. Resistance at $5.62 aligns with a recent peak and a volume‑weighted average price zone. A break above that level would need to occur on above‑average volume to be considered valid. The current downtrend line from the $6.00 area also acts as resistance, converging near $5.62. The overall chart structure suggests the stock is in a consolidation phase between these two boundaries, with the break‑out direction likely to set the next medium‑term trend. This approach balances convenience with responsiveness in fast-moving markets. Looking ahead, the $5.08 support level is the most immediate line in the sand. If buying interest emerges at this zone, the stock could stage a short‑term bounce toward resistance at $5.62, and potentially higher toward the $6.00 psychological level. A decisive break above resistance would require a catalyst, such as a positive earnings surprise, new product or service announcements, or broader market tailwinds. Conversely, if the stock breaks below $5.08 on elevated volume, it may open the door to further downside toward the next support near $4.50 or lower. Factors that could influence the direction include upcoming quarterly results, changes in consumer spending trends, competitive landscape shifts, and overall market sentiment toward small‑cap growth stocks. Traders should monitor volume patterns at support — a low‑volume test that holds could be constructive, while a high‑volume breakdown would be more bearish.
